Why Wetsuits Matter for Water Sports Lovers

Wetsuits constitute vital equipment for water-based sports devotees, supplying safety and comfort in multiple aquatic conditions. These garments supply thermal insulation, keeping the body warm in cold waters, which is essential for sustaining stamina and performance. Moreover, wetsuits protect the skin from abrasions, stings, and dangerous UV rays, enabling individuals to partake in activities such as surfing, diving, and snorkeling with minimized risk of injury.

The lift given by wetsuits improves overall results, allowing easier navigation and superior control in the water. This lift aids divers in maintaining their lift while surveying underwater regions. Additionally, the close fit of a wetsuit prevents water entry, guaranteeing that individuals remain mobile and dedicated on their sport. For water sports enthusiasts, the right wetsuit becomes an crucial tool, contributing greatly both protection and gratification during their aquatic adventures.

Fundamental Components Your Wetsuit Demands

When picking a wetsuit, understanding the must-have features is vital for boosting performance and comfort in the water. A properly fitted wetsuit ensures minimal water entry, enhancing thermal insulation and buoyancy. The thickness of the neoprene material plays a significant role; typically, a 3mm to 5mm thickness is recommended depending on water temperature.

Another important feature is sealed seams, which prevent water from seeping in, thus ensuring warmth during extended sessions. Flexibility is key for unrestricted movement, making elements such as ergonomic panels and strategic cutouts important. Additionally, a reliable zipper system, either on the back or front, should permit easy entry and exit while staying watertight.

Finally, consider extra components like strengthened knee sections for durability and wrist and ankle fasteners for a secure fit. These features work together to an superior diving journey, ensuring both comfort and performance in multiple water sports endeavors.

Neoprene Measurement Differences

The variability in neoprene thickness is an important factor that greatly influences both comfort and flexibility in diving wetsuits. Thicker neoprene offers increased insulation, making it suitable for colder waters, while thinner options enhance breathability and decrease bulk. The choice of thickness affects how well the wetsuit adapts to the body, impacting overall fit and freedom of movement. A well-designed wetsuit utilizes varying thicknesses strategically, allowing for better thermal protection in vital areas while maintaining flexibility in joints and limbs. This balance guarantees that divers can enjoy extended periods in the water without feeling restricted. Ultimately, understanding neoprene thickness variability is essential for selecting the appropriate wetsuit tailored to specific diving conditions and personal comfort preferences.

Measuring Your Body Dimensions

Getting the perfect fit for a diving wetsuit depends on precise body measurements. To begin, one must obtain a flexible measuring tape and take several important measurements: chest, waist, hips, inseam, and height. The chest measurement is essential for ensuring that the suit fits snugly around the torso, while the waist and hip measurements help adjust the fit around the midsection and lower body. The inseam measurement helps determine the length of the legs, ensuring proper coverage. Finally, height gives an overall scale for the suit's dimensions. It is recommended to wear minimal clothing while measuring for the most accurate results. Precise measurements will greatly improve comfort and performance in water sports, ensuring a superior diving experience.

Learning About Wetsuit Thickness Alternatives

When choosing a wetsuit, understanding the various thickness alternatives is essential for ideal performance and comfort in different water conditions. Wetsuits typically span 2mm to 7mm in thickness, affecting flexibility and insulation. A 2mm suit is suitable for warm water, providing minimal thermal protection while allowing range of motion. In contrast, a 5mm wetsuit offers a balance for cooler waters, ensuring adequate warmth without sacrificing flexibility. For frigid conditions, a 7mm suit is recommended, delivering maximum insulation but potentially limiting mobility. It's important to take into account personal tolerance to cold, the duration of water exposure, and activity type when choosing a thickness. Ultimately, the right fit improves both comfort and performance during aquatic adventures.

Temperature Management: Staying Thermal Energy in Frigid Waters

In cold water environments, effective thermal regulation is imperative for maintaining comfort and safety during water-based activities. Thermal wetsuits are fashioned to trap a thin layer of water against the skin, which heats up from body heat, producing an insulating barrier. The material and thickness composition of a thermal suit profoundly determine its thermal performance; neoprene is the most common choice due to its excellent heat-insulating qualities.

Furthermore, wetsuits often feature components including sealed seams and insulating layers to maximize heat retention. The shape of the wetsuit remains essential; a fitted design limits water exchange, avoiding get started the depletion of thermal energy.

In chilly conditions, water sports athletes may choose additional accessories like hoods, hand protection, and foot coverings to enhance temperature regulation. By understanding these factors of temperature control, water sports enthusiasts can determine proper equipment to guarantee a pleasant time in frigid conditions.

Selecting the Right Wetsuit Style for You

Picking the suitable wetsuit type can greatly affect comfort and performance during water sports. Various factors influence this decision, including water temperature, activity type, and personal fit preference.

Full wetsuits, encompassing the whole body, are ideal for frigid waters, delivering optimal insulation. Meanwhile, shorty wetsuits, which have abbreviated sleeves and legs, provide more range of motion and are better suited for warmer conditions. For those engaged in intense activities like surfing, a lighter wetsuit may improve flexibility without sacrificing too much heat retention.

Moreover, it is important to analyze the composition. Neoprene thickness fluctuates, with thicker options providing more warmth but reduced mobility. Conversely, thinner textiles enable for greater agility but may require additional thermal layers in colder environments. Ultimately, individuals should assess their specific needs and preferences to select the wetsuit type that will improve their experience in the water.

Practical Advice for Protecting Your Neoprene Suit

Proper maintenance for a wetsuit can greatly extend its durability and maintain its functionality. After each use, it is crucial to rinse the wetsuit completely with fresh water to remove salt, sand, and chlorine that can degrade the fabric. Avoid using strong soaps; instead, opt for specialized wetsuit cleaners.

As it dries, the wetsuit should be hung inside out in a shadowed area, out of direct sunlight, which can cause color loss and break down neoprene. Storing the wetsuit extended or on a wide hanger reduces creasing and retains its shape.

Monitor regularly for marks of deterioration, such as tears or leaks, and repair them right away to prevent extra wear. Lastly, avoid placing your feet on the wetsuit when putting it on or taking it off, as this may cause undue expansion or breaking. Meticulous upkeep ensures superior execution and delight in water sports.

What Indicators Reveal a Impaired Wetsuit?

Visible tears, thinning material, peeling neoprene, and compromised seams are signs of a worn wetsuit. Additionally, water leaks during operation or an strange odor may suggest deterioration, requiring fixing or replacement for peak performance.

Can Neoprene suits Lead to Skin Irritation?

Yes, wetsuits can cause irritated skin due to reasons like poor fitting, material allergies, or long-term contact. Manifestations may include red patches, rubbing discomfort, or allergic reactions, encouraging users to explore substitute materials or better-fitting options.

When Should I Replace My Wetsuit Most Often?

Wetsuits ought to be replaced every 3-5 years, influenced by intensity of use and proper maintenance. Marks of deterioration, such as pallor or separation at seams, reveal that purchasing a replacement is necessary to copyright effectiveness.
